Solar energy is an innovative
concept. “Solar power is produced by collecting sunlight and converting it into
electricity. This is done by using solar panels, which are large flat panels
made up of many individual solar cells.” (AE Solar Power, 2014) Now solar
energy isn’t exactly a new concept. People have used solar energy as a catalyst
to fuel electricity in certain parts of the world where electricity is too
difficult to develop by other means.
Solar power has even been used to power the simplest of devices, such as
calculators. However, with the latest research and development, solar power may
just now finally be hitting its true stride.
There are many reasons as to why
solar energy is now entering mainstream. First off, the cost has gone down
considerably. Julie Jacobson has stated, “The challenge several years ago was
not just the price – what with all of the overly generous utility and
government subsidies – but the access. It was a complicated mess with high
up-front costs and multiple vendors and contractors. The process today is
streamlined, as providers have honed their sales and installation process”
(David Glenn, Technica.com). This is very significant. Technology can be as
amazing as it can allow itself to be, but without the ability of it to reach
the average consumer because of a high price, it will never make it to its full
potential. With the price point reaching a low point, the nation would be able
to adopt it and then the positive benefits can be seen within society. In
addition, the production of solar energy panels have increased over the years.
Whenever production of a product increases, companies have more then likely
found ways to reduce the raw materials needed to manufacture the product. If
production costs have gone down, then the price for the consumer will go down
even further, which will then make the reduced price point even more
attractive. “New materials (such as perovskites) are becoming even cheaper to
manufacture, more efficient at converting energy” (David Glenn, Technica.com).

There is one major drawback to solar
energy that I can think of, and that is trying to obtain energy when the sun
goes down. If solar energy is inexpensive, individuals would want to stick with
it in favor of their standard electric power that they are paying now. So this
makes for a highly ironic scenario. People will have the light during the
daytime (when it’s generally not used as much) and not have light during the
nighttime (when the demand for it obviously grows). This would mean that the
entire solar power movement which was designed to give people access to
inexpensive light, would end up making it darker then it would brighter. “Solar energy can only be harnessed when it is daytime and
sunny, in countries such as the UK, the unreliable climate means that solar
energy is also unreliable as a source of energy. Cloudy skies reduce its
effectiveness.” (V. Ryan, TechnologyStudent.com).
